Wood‑eating pests survived mainly on cellulose, a natural compound found in abundance within a home's structural framing, floorboards, window casings, and outdoor timber components. As these insects move through underground mud galleries, their damage stays completely hid for months and even years. House owners normally just become aware of a major invasion when they find isolated softened areas in wood skirtings, split plaster walls, or doors that unexpectedly won't latch properly. By the time such clear surface signs appear, the surprise timber may already be thoroughly damaged, highlighting the crucial need for early detection.
When a live termite nest is found inside a structure, the first goal is to stop additional damage by employing precise control methods. An expert termite service in Canberra normally starts with a kill phase that utilizes non-repellent powders, specialized foams, or development regulators used directly into the active tunnels. These modern items are formulated to act slowly, enabling the foraging employees to survive long enough to transfer the agent back to the main nest. As the bugs groom each other and share food, the chemical spreads throughout the colony, eventually removing the queen and triggering the whole nest to collapse.
After the instant indoor infestation has actually been totally eliminated, the focus moves to installing lasting boundary defenses that prevent future incursions. The most frequently relied‑upon technique includes forming an uninterrupted chemical barrier in the soil surrounding the structure's outside foundation walls. Professionals carefully dig a trench down to the footings, soak the exposed earth with a specifically formulated liquid termiticide, and after that backfill the trench. On homes where strong concrete sidewalks, driveways, or outdoor patios sit directly against the external brickwork, employees drill exact holes into the surface to inject the liquid into the underlying soil, subsequently sealing the entry points so they mix flawlessly with the surrounding location.
Another trustworthy option is to establish an integrated boundary tracking and baiting system. This technique works especially well for homes on steep grades, split‑level designs, or residential or commercial properties with detailed maintaining walls where digging conventional trenches isn't possible. Bait stations are put in the soil at calculated points around the house's edge to lure and catch foraging colonies check here before they reach the structure. Specialists examine these stations regularly, using an attractive bait mix as soon as pest activity is discovered, thereby getting rid of the targeted foraging group before it can locate an entry into the home.
Selecting the right management system copyrights mainly on a structure's age, construction style, and accurate area. Structures that are older and located in well‑established, leafy suburbs adjacent to bushland reserves bring a significantly greater danger than recently constructed homes, which generally get physical protective steps during building. No matter which defensive system is used, scheduling extensive yearly inspections is an important responsibility of homeowner. These annual checks guarantee that the safeguards have actually not been unintentionally damaged or prevented by recent garden work, soil motion, or firewood piled straight against outside walls.
Employing licensed pest control specialists makes sure that all restorative work is performed in rigorous accordance with recognized nationwide security and efficiency standards. Attempting to deal with a subterranean pest issue utilizing over-the-counter retail sprays or unverified do it yourself techniques frequently backfires, causing the colony to scatter and move to another susceptible section of the home.
